An hour by ferry from Naples, the island of Ischia charms with bargain-priced five-star inns, wineries and thermal hot springs. Photo / Getty Images

NEW ZEALAND HERALD:Aug 26, 2024

More than 65 million people travel to Italy each year — the fifth most-visited country in international tourism, according to the World Tourism Organisation. To find a luxury, lesser-known locale in a sea of vacationers, try the country’s southwest island of Ischia.
